2020 term 3 week 4: Hyperlinks & CSS
Web Design students have finished learning ways to incorporate graphics into our html. Next week, we will work with adding hyperlinks, and will discuss relative and absolute hyperlinks. This will now allow us to only link to other pages, but also begin creating sites of multiple pages that are linked to eachother. We will then start learning CSS. Students have been working really hard, and learning a lot, and I really couldn't be happier with their progress and participation in class. 2020 term 3 week 2: introduction to html
Last week in web design, students learned about basic principles of web design, and were able to create sitemaps and wireframes to plan out web sites. We then started learning how to start web pages by learning rules for file names, organizing folders, and starting the skeleton of our html files.
